Travel from West Byfleet to Worthing by train in 2 hours

If you want to know more about the journey from West Byfleet to Worthing by train, look no further!

The average journey time from West Byfleet to Worthing by train is 2 hours 33 minutes, although on the fastest services it can take just 2 hours. You'll usually find 42 trains per day travelling the 36 miles (59 km) between these two destinations. You'll need to make 1 change along the way to Worthing. You'll be travelling with Great Western Railway, South Western Railway or Thameslink on your way to Worthing, as these are the main rail operators on this route.

Cheap train tickets from West Byfleet to Worthing

Book in advance

Look out for Advance tickets – they usually come out up to 12 weeks before the departure date and can be cheaper than buying on the day. If you’re here a tad early, sign up for our Advance ticket alert today to get notified when your tickets are released.

Consider a Season Ticket

If you catch this train more than 3 times per week, you could save money with a Season Ticket. With annual, monthly and weekly options available, find out if a season ticket for West Byfleet to Worthing is right for you.

Use your Railcard

National Railcards offer a 1/3 off eligible train tickets in the UK and can be a great investment if you travel a few times or more in a year. Find out how you can save with a National Railcard here.
